Logging in to the Web interface
To log in to the IMM2.1 Web interface, do the following:
Step 1.
On a system that is connected to the server, open a Web browser. In the Address or URL field,
type the IP address or host name of the IMM2.1 to which you want to connect.
Note: If you are logging on to the IMM2.1 for the first time after installation, the IMM2.1 defaults to
DHCP. If a DHCP host is not available, the IMM2.1 assigns a static IP address of 192.168.70.125.
The IMM2.1 network access tag provides the default host name of the IMM2.1 and does not
require you to start the server.
Step 2.
On the Login page, type the user name and password. If you are using the IMM2.1 for the first time,
you can obtain the user name and password from your system administrator. All login attempts are
documented in the system-event log.
Note: The IMM2.1 is set initially with a user name of USERID and password of PASSW0RD (with a
zero, not the letter O). You have read and write access. You must change the default password the
first time you log in.
Step 3.
Click Log in to start the session. The System Status and Health page provides a quick view of the
system status.
